Phil Kessel's late heroics help Penguins even East final with Sens
Phil Kessel scored at 13:05 of the third period to break up a goaltending duel and give the Pittsburgh Penguins a 1-0 win over the Ottawa Senators in Game 2 of the Eastern Conference final Monday night at PPG Paints Arena. That gives the teams a 1-1 split heading to Ottawa for the next two games. Game 3 […]

Pageau scores 4, including double-OT winner as Sens take 2-0 series lead
Too much chicken parmesan left Jean-Gabriel Pageau feeling a little full before Saturday’s matinee against the New York Rangers. It didn’t matter. The 24-year-old put together a “legendary game” at Canadian Tire Centre by scoring a career-high four goals, including the 6-5 double overtime winner. Victory gave Ottawa a 2-0 series lead in the playoffs for only […]
Sens close in on division lead with win over Leafs
The Ottawa Senators have the Atlantic Division lead in their sights. Mark Stone had a career-high four assists and five points as the Senators earned their fourth win in the last five games Saturday night with a 6-3 victory over the struggling Toronto Maple Leafs. Ottawa (68 points) now trails Montreal (70 points) by only […]
